Mahindra Ugine Steel sells 51% stake to Mahindra & Mahindra

18 Jun 2013 Evaluate

Mahindra Ugine Steel Company has sold of entire shareholding of 51, 00,000 equity shares of Rs 10 each held by the company in Mahindra Sanyo Special Steel (MSSSPL), a subsidiary of the company, constituting 51% of the equity share capital of MSSSPL, to Mahindra & Mahindra for an aggregate consideration of Rs 214.33 crore.

The said consideration is as per the Valuation Report of an Independent professional firm. The above proposal for sale of investment in MSSSPL is subject to necessary approvals, as may be required. The Committee of Directors of the company at its meeting held on June 15, 2013 has approved for the same.

Mahindra Ugine Steel Company is engaged in the manufacturing of alloy & special steel through Electric Arc Furnace (EAF) route & caters to the automotive, engineering, bearing & other industries. The company manufactures a wide array of products including skin components, underbody components, critical assemblies, chassis components and car body sheet metal (Body in White) parts with a total capacity of 30,000 metric tons.
